Later that day we got more deer food from the neighbour. The deer food is provided by the local hunters. As the roe deer population on our mountain is low, they keep a close eye on it. Providing locals with feed for them so they get through the longgggg winter. So the roe deer population can grow come spring. So I agreed to feed the roe deer on our part of the mountain and they provide me with the feed. Mainly crushed barley and other grains. We can also put out peels from fruit and potatoes etc.

We built an automatic feeder and attached it to the birch tree at the end of the path, up right from the bird feeder tree ๐ณ It will take some time for the deer to get used to it. So we have put the feeder around it until they will eat from the feeder.
Also the spots the roe deer are familiar with we keep topped up as they come anytime during the day and night.
